2014 CDF to CVE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2014

During 2014, the CDF to CVE ex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on December 31, valuing the pair at 0.0982.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on March 14, dropping to 0.0851.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.0131 CVE.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 0.0873 to the December average rate of 0.0964, the exchange rate registered a net change of 10.35% (reflecting a strengthening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2014 high of 0.0982 was up 4.72% compared to the 2013 peak of 0.0938,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.
